We are looking for an experienced Control Systems Engineer to join a growing team, working on the development of advanced control systems for complex electromechanical, optical, aerospace, and robotic applications.

As a Control Systems Engineer, you will:

  • Deliver technical documentation and provide technical support to the Software team to implement control algorithms
  • Develop and maintain Hardware-in-the-Loop (HIL) real-time simulations to test control software requirements against simulation models
  • Perform trade-off analysis of different control concepts, components, and system architectures
  • Maintain pointing budgets and ensure control systems meet overall system requirements
  • Work closely with multidisciplinary engineering teams to develop, test, and verify advanced control solutions

The successful candidate will have:

  • At least 3 years of relevant commercial experience developing control systems for complex electromechanical, optical, aerospace, or robotic systems
  • A degree in Control Engineering, Electrical or Electronic Engineering, Robotics, Aerospace Engineering, Physics, or a related technical discipline
  • Practical experience designing, modelling, implementing, and testing control algorithms for dynamic systems
  • Proficiency with MATLAB and Simulink, or equivalent modelling and simulation platforms
  • The ability to translate system-level requirements into control-system requirements, test cases, and verification activities
  • Strong analytical and problem-solving skills, with the ability to diagnose complex system behaviour using test data and simulations
